Key Features to Consider
When assessing various robot vacuum, several essential features can aid in making an informed decision. Below are some necessary aspects to consider:
1. Suction Power
- The suction power is important for picking up dirt and particles successfully. Look for models with adjustable suction settings for different floor types.
2. Navigation Technology
- Advanced models utilize laser mapping and cams, permitting them to browse efficiently around challenges and draw up rooms for targeted cleaning.
3. Battery Life
- Think about how long the vacuum can run on a single charge. A longer battery life makes sure more comprehensive cleaning sessions before requiring to charge.
4. Size and Design
- A compact design permits the robot to tidy under furniture and in hard-to-reach areas. Examine dimensions to guarantee it suits your home design.
5. Dustbin Capacity
- Larger dustbins need less regular emptying. Evaluate just how robot mop and vacuum can hold before requiring to be emptied.
6. Smart Features
- Connection options, such as Wi-Fi and app control, permit remote scheduling and monitoring. Voice control abilities through assistants like Alexa or Google Assistant can also improve use.
7. Cost
- Robot vacuums range from affordable to high-end models, so consider your cleaning requirements and spending plan when making a choice.
8. Customer Reviews and Warranty
- Research study user feedback to comprehend the strengths and weak points of each design. A solid guarantee can offer peace of mind about your purchase.

Advantages and disadvantages of Robot Vacuum Cleaners
Pros
- Time-Saving: Robot vacuum can automate day-to-day cleaning jobs, maximizing time for other activities.
- Convenience: Many designs can be controlled via apps, permitting users to set up cleaning on-the-go.
- Consistency: Regular cleaning sessions can prevent the accumulation of dirt and allergens in a home.
- Availability: Robot vacuums can reach spaces that standard models frequently can not, such as under furnishings.
Cons
- Restricted Capacity: Most robot vacuums have a smaller dustbin compared to standard vacuum, requiring regular emptying.
- Rate: High-end models can be costly, and budget models might lack important functions.
- Surface Limitations: Some robot vacuums might deal with particular surfaces, such as high-pile carpets.
- Upkeep: Brushes and filters require routine cleaning and replacement to keep optimal performance.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: How do robot vacuum cleaners work?Robot vacuums are equipped with sensors and brushes that help them browse a space while collecting dirt and debris. Their smart mapping innovation enables them to create a layout of the home, making it possible for efficient cleaning patterns.
Q2: Can robot vacuums tidy several surfaces?Yes, many robot vacuum are designed to deal with a variety of surface areas, consisting of wood, tile, and low to medium-pile carpets. However, some might be less reliable on high-pile carpets.
Q3: How frequently should I run my robot vacuum?It's usually advised to run a robot vacuum at least as soon as a week. Nevertheless, households with animals or large quantities of foot traffic might benefit from daily cleaning.
Q4: Are robot vacuums worth the investment?If time and convenience are high priorities, a robot vacuum can be a rewarding investment. It automates a vital chore, permitting house owners to concentrate on other tasks.
Q5: How much sound do robot vacuum cleaners make?A lot of robot vacuums operate at a noise level comparable to conventional vacuums but may vary by design. Research user evaluates for sound levels if this is a concern.
